Newfoundland Vinyl: The Greatest Hits

In Newfoundland’s Gros Morne National Park, one of the most naturally beautiful places on Earth, this Summer there’s near 33 1/3 revolutions of “Newfoundland Vinyl’ – the stage hit that keeps spinning joyfully.

Canadian playwright+ Jeff Pitcher, Artistic Director of Theatre Newfoundland and Labrador since 2000, previews things in this clip from film-maker Peter Buckle: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=yS-dxh1Pd00



After catching Vinyl’s “The Greatest Hits” edition live, he says “what an amazing cast. So much truth, honesty and affiliation with the artists that wrote our famous songs. Moments like this I'm so proud to be the AD of this company.”

Since 2012, when ‘Vinyl’ was conceived by Pitcher, Allison Crowe has served as Musical Director for the production at TNL’s annual Gros Morne Theatre Festival. In the GMTF 2016 program, Crowe notes: “Going over ideas for this year's ‘Vinyl’, I couldn't help but be a little jealous of the song selection that makes up the 'best of...' theme. So much so, in fact, that I wanted to be in the show! As MD, I’ve had a lot of fun choosing songs and hearing them performed night after night – and, over the years, I was always in the audience singing along. Now, I join the cast with a mix of great music from years previous and a bunch of songs we've never done before - so excited to share it all with you!”

Renewing popular and traditional NL songs of the vinyl (record) era, sounding brilliant and looking sharp in period dress, the show’s cast/band features: Dave Baird; Adam Christopher Brake (as Ed); Allison Crowe; Craig Patrick Haley; Robyn Huxter; Marquita Walsh; and Colin Furlong in a guest appearance singing Ron Hynes.

On board Vinyl’s production team: Director & Musical Director – Allison Crowe; Stage Manager – Stefanie Power; Set Design – Derek Butt; Set Coordination – Howard Beye; Costume Coordination – Lindsay Code; Sound Design –Max Simms; and Lighting Coordination – Jeff Pybus.

Now playing three to four nights a week through to September 2, 2016 in The Ethie Room of the Shallow Bay Motel Cabins & Conference Centre, Cow Head, NL. "Newfoundland Vinyl" Opens!

The curtain rises tonight for the opening of “Newfoundland Vinyl”. The show’s sold-out and there’s a waiting list for folks to enjoy this pressing of a perennial favourite at Newfoundland’s fabulous Gros Morne Theatre Festival!

The GMTF’s 20th anniversary season is underway – and it’s real celebration of the creative family that is Theatre Newfoundland and Labrador (the Atlantic Canadian professional theatre company founded in 1979).

Conceived by TNL’s Artistic Director, Jeff Pitcher, the hit-stage show “Newfoundland Vinyl” is under the Musical Direction of Allison Crowe who’s been with the production from its launch in 2012.

Newfoundland Vinyl - logo by Ed Hollet

TNL describes the show opening tonight: “Hits of the 1960’s, 70’s and 80’s by Newfoundland’s biggest recording stars come to life! For your toe-tapping, tear-jerking enjoyment the music and songs of Ryan’s Fancy, Harry Hibbs, Gary O’Driscoll, Dick Nolan, Joan Morrissey, Bob Porter and more! A magical evening of music and madness with the hilarious Ed and Edna (Ed’s long-lost 3rd cousin twice removed) as show hosts!”

The wonderfully-talented cast bringing music and vitality to stage for Summer 2015 are:
Adam Brake, Craig Haley, Claire Hewlett, Stephanie Payne, Keelan Purchase, and Marquita Walsh. The production team is: Musical Director, Allison Crowe; Stage Manager, Stefanie Power; Sound Design, Max Simms; Set Design, Derek Butt; Set Coordination, Lisa Lahue; Costume Coordination, Lindsay Code; Original Lighting Design, Johnny Cann; and Lighting Coordination, Andrew Scriver.

“I have had such a wonderful time learning this year's crop of songs for Newfoundland Vinyl - from waltzes and parlour songs, to torch songs, to songs with the same spirit as 1960s protest anthems and beyond - simply great music from throughout the decades,” notes Allison. “The silly, the sentimental, the sad, and serene all converge in this GMTF show. I'm so happy that you're here to experience our talented cast performing for you with their hearts and souls. And what a gorgeous location for it! So, please, enjoy and do sing along!”

Newfoundland Vinyl” runs June 13 - August 28, 2015 – with performances each Tuesday and Friday in the Ethie Room, Shallow Bay Motel and Cabins. "Newfoundland VinyI: The 'C' Side" Opens

Allison Crowe (@Allison_Crowe), tweets: “Tech week for NL Vinyl this week – we open on Friday – and we are already SOLD OUT for opening night!”
Now it's opening night! The Western Star reports:

Crowe home again for ‘Newfoundland Vinyl’

Allison Crowe is back home again from international concert touring to serve as musical director of Theatre Newfoundland and Labrador’s hit show “Newfoundland Vinyl” at this year’s Gros Morne Theatre Festival.
“Newfoundland Vinyl’ is back!”  the theatre company says in a prepared release. “Allison Crowe has made this show into a perennial festival favourite. The vinyl Newfoundland hits of the 60s, 70s and 80s by Newfoundland's biggest recording stars are never-ending.”
This year’s production promises hits from Harry Hibbs’ “The Wild Rover” and Eddy Coffey’s “Area Code 709” to Corey & Trina’s “Northern Lights of Labrador
The show spins each Tuesday and Friday from Friday until Aug. 29. The cast features musicians/actors Colin Furlong, Craig Haley, Claire Hewlett, Amelia Manuel, Stephanie Payne, Keelan Purchase and Marquita Walsh, with Adam Christopher Brake as Ed.


The show is directed by Crowe and Jeff Pitcher.

Then on July 28, in a special solo performance, Crowe Sings "Newfoundland Vinyl" and more in the "Who's Darkening Our Door" Concert Series at the Warehouse Theatre in Cow Head.
